When my system comes up with no logged-on users but with syslogd, pflogd, ntpd, sshd, sendmail, inetd, and sndiod running, top shows 24M of real memory consumption. When I start emacs server (emacs --daemon) storage consumption increases to 59M, more than 2x what is required by OpenBSD itself and several daemons.
